HB136 Alabama 2017 Session

Login or Sign Up to follow this page. It's free!
Crossed Over

Bill Summary

Sponsors
  • David Faulkner
Session
Regular Session 2017
Title
Municipality, council-manager form of gov., council-manager act of 1982, composition of council, alternate forms, Sec. 11-43A-8 am'd.
Description
<p class="bill_description"> Under existing law, a municipality may adopt the council-manager form of government pursuant to Article 1 of Chapter 43A of Title 11, Code of Alabama 1975, the Council-Manager Act of 1982. In that case, the council is composed of five members</p><p class="bill_description"> The mayor and one council member are elected at large and three council members are elected from single-member districts. In addition, an alternate form for the composition of the council is provided for in Class 6 municipalities with a mayor and eight council members</p><p class="bill_description"> This bill would authorize a municipality organized under the first form provided above to have a council composed of either five or seven members with a mayor elected at large and either four or six council members elected either at large or from single-member districts</p><p class="bill_entitled_an_act"> To amend Section 11-43A-8 of the Code of Alabama 1975, the Council-Manager Act of 1982, to authorize alternate forms of organization and election of the members of the council. </p>
